Functions
Collaboration diagram for TIM Private Functions:

Functions

void TIM_Base_SetConfig (TIM_TypeDef *TIMx, TIM_Base_InitTypeDef *Structure)
 
void TIM_CCxChannelCmd (TIM_TypeDef *TIMx, uint32_t Channel, uint32_t ChannelState)
 
void TIM_DMACaptureCplt (DMA_HandleTypeDef *hdma)
 
void TIM_DMACaptureHalfCplt (DMA_HandleTypeDef *hdma)
 
void TIM_DMADelayPulseCplt (DMA_HandleTypeDef *hdma)
 
void TIM_DMADelayPulseHalfCplt (DMA_HandleTypeDef *hdma)
 
void TIM_DMAError (DMA_HandleTypeDef *hdma)
 
void TIM_ETR_SetConfig (TIM_TypeDef *TIMx, uint32_t TIM_ExtTRGPrescaler, uint32_t TIM_ExtTRGPolarity, uint32_t ExtTRGFilter)
 
void TIM_OC2_SetConfig (TIM_TypeDef *TIMx, TIM_OC_InitTypeDef *OC_Config)
 
void TIM_TI1_SetConfig (TIM_TypeDef *TIMx, uint32_t TIM_ICPolarity, uint32_t TIM_ICSelection, uint32_t TIM_ICFilter)
 

Detailed Description

Function Documentation

◆ TIM_Base_SetConfig()

void TIM_Base_SetConfig ( TIM_TypeDef TIMx,
TIM_Base_InitTypeDef Structure 
)

◆ TIM_CCxChannelCmd()

void TIM_CCxChannelCmd ( TIM_TypeDef TIMx,
uint32_t  Channel,
uint32_t  ChannelState 
)

◆ TIM_DMACaptureCplt()

void TIM_DMACaptureCplt ( DMA_HandleTypeDef hdma)

◆ TIM_DMACaptureHalfCplt()

void TIM_DMACaptureHalfCplt ( DMA_HandleTypeDef hdma)

◆ TIM_DMADelayPulseCplt()

void TIM_DMADelayPulseCplt ( DMA_HandleTypeDef hdma)

◆ TIM_DMADelayPulseHalfCplt()

void TIM_DMADelayPulseHalfCplt ( DMA_HandleTypeDef hdma)

◆ TIM_DMAError()

void TIM_DMAError ( DMA_HandleTypeDef hdma)

◆ TIM_ETR_SetConfig()

void TIM_ETR_SetConfig ( TIM_TypeDef TIMx,
uint32_t  TIM_ExtTRGPrescaler,
uint32_t  TIM_ExtTRGPolarity,
uint32_t  ExtTRGFilter 
)

◆ TIM_OC2_SetConfig()

void TIM_OC2_SetConfig ( TIM_TypeDef TIMx,
TIM_OC_InitTypeDef OC_Config 
)

◆ TIM_TI1_SetConfig()

void TIM_TI1_SetConfig ( TIM_TypeDef TIMx,
uint32_t  TIM_ICPolarity,
uint32_t  TIM_ICSelection,
uint32_t  TIM_ICFilter 
)


picovoice_driver
Author(s):
autogenerated on Fri Apr 1 2022 02:15:07